Handover: Shrinkray CLI (batch image resizing). Owner is now you. It walks a manifest, resizes in parallel, writes to the Tidepool bucket. Known issues: EXIF rotation on old uploads, memory spikes on TIFFs over 200 MB. Tests live in the same repo; run them before any release. It reads one config file at startup, shown here in full.

config for bahop-fajep:
DRUATH_PIN=4501
DRUATH_TENANT=briwyn
DRUATH_METRICS_HOST=metrics.druath.brasksoft.test
DRUATH_SEAL=seal_7d2e069d
DRUATH_STANDBY_TEAM=olieth

## Log Sampling for Murmuret

Murmuret is our chattiest service, emitting roughly 40k log lines per minute at steady state, most of them per-request debug noise. To keep ingestion costs sane, we sample INFO-level logs at 5% and DEBUG at 1%, while ERROR and WARN pass through unsampled. Sampling rates live in the Fluxgate config and can be adjusted at runtime without a deploy. If an investigation needs full fidelity, you can temporarily raise the rates for up to two hours. The procedure and rollback steps are on the internal page.

runbook for badug-kadup: https://confluence.zemvarlabs.internal/projects/browse/display/projects/bd1b

Leadership Review Briefing — Heads of Department

Roughly 46% of Tarnbeck Industries' revenue now comes from a single client, Osmure Logistics. A contract lapse or pricing renegotiation would materially affect all divisions. Mitigation options include accelerating the Westharrow pipeline and diversifying into mid-market accounts. Our intended response is set out in confidence below.

internal memo for kahop-yajof: The steering committee signed off on a budget of $12.6 million for Project Jorwyn. The renewal with Quenoxox Logistics closes at $16.8 million a year, 48 percent above the last contract.

CI Troubleshooting Note — Mistvault Bloom Filter Layer

For the security review: intermittent CI failures in the Mistvault pipeline trace to the bloom filter fronting the Keelstone key-value store. Under parallel test shards, the filter is seeded with a fixed salt, so false-positive rates spike and read-through tests flake. We've randomized the seed per shard and capped filter size. The fix was verified on the pipeline run identified below.

trace token, fafog-kageg: htk4_98e6